Have you looked in the folder where your apps are stored? On Windows XP the default location is: C:\Documents and Settings\[username]\My Documents\My Music\iTunes\Mobile Applications If they're in there you can drag and drop them onto the applications tab of iTunes... if they've been deleted you'll have to download them again.
